Adekunle Gold, Mimi Omolaja to host 2017 Future Awards Africa
Award-winning Nigerian singer and songwriter, Adekunle Gold and TV personality Mimi Omolaja will be hosting the 2017 edition of The Future Awards Africa.
The event which is the 12th edition will take place on Saturday, December 9 at the Federal Palace Hotel, Lagos.
This was announced by the Central working committee of the forthcoming event.
This year awards which is themed Nigeria’s New Tribe will acknowledge inspiring young Nigerians who are between age 18 and 31 who have been making a wave in the social enterprise, social works, and creativity.
With 105 nominees selected over categories including Music, Beauty, Fashion & Design, Professional Service, Sports and more, 21 winners will be announced at the event, including the highly-coveted ‘Young Person of the Year’.
